I found some noncompliance between
draft-rosenberg-mmusic-sdp-offer-answer-00.txt (refered to as
"offer-answer") and draft-ietf-sip-service-examples-03.txt (refered to
as "examples"), can someone help to explain?

1. In� "offer-answer" section 3.1, it is stated that "If a stream is
offered as sendonly, the corresponding stream MUST be marked as recvonly
in the answer."

An example of noncompliance can be found in "examples" section 2.1, F10
& F12.

2. In "offer-answer" section 4, it is stated that "When issuing an offer
that modifies the session, the o line of the new SDP MUST be identical
to that in the previous SDP, except that the version in the origin field
MUST increment from the previous SDP."

An example of noncompliance can be found in "examples" section 2.1, F6 &
F10.
